What Are Sour Gummy Worms? An Overview of Their Shape, Texture, and Popularity
Sour gummy worms are brightly colored, uniquely worm-shaped gummy candies. Their biggest appeal lies in the perfect combination of sweetness and tartness, along with their chewy, elastic texture. The pleasantly tangy flavor is addictive, making them popular with everyone from kids to adults.
Typically, they are slender worms about 5–8 cm long, coated with a sour powder for that signature kick. The gummies are soft, and each bite fills your mouth with fruity flavors and a burst of tartness.
Their popularity stems from their eye-catching appearance and the wide variety of flavors available. You can enjoy several flavors—like cherry, lemon, orange, and apple—in a single bag, which is a major plus.

Major Producing Countries and Brand Origins
The most iconic sour gummy worm brand is Germany’s “Trolli.” Trolli invented the gummy worm in 1975 and launched the sour version in 1981. Their popularity grew rapidly in the US and Europe.
American brands like Albanese and SmartSweets are also gaining attention, especially for their health-conscious and low-sugar options. These brands cater to a wide range of needs through creative flavors and ingredients.
| Brand Name | Country of Origin | Main Features |
|---|---|---|
| Trolli | Germany | Original sour gummy worm, intense tartness |
| Albanese | USA | Low sugar, gluten-free options |
| SmartSweets | USA | Low calorie, high in dietary fiber |

Ingredients, Nutrition Facts, and Health & Diet Information for sour gummy worms
Typical Ingredients and Use of Additives
Sour gummy worms are beloved by many for their distinctive tartness and vibrant colors. The main ingredients include gelatin, sugar, corn syrup, acidulants (such as citric acid and lactic acid), flavorings, and colorings. While many products use artificial colorings and flavorings, recently there has been an increase in products made with naturally derived ingredients.
Below is a table comparing representative ingredients.
| Item | Example Contents |
|---|---|
| Main Ingredients | Gelatin, sugar, corn syrup |
| Acidulants | Citric acid, lactic acid, fumaric acid |
| Flavorings/Colors | Artificial (Red 40, Blue 1, etc.), Natural (fruit juice extracts, etc.) |
| Other Additives | Vegetable oil, waxes |
Depending on the product, you can also choose brands that do not use artificial preservatives or that focus on more natural ingredients.
Calories, Carbohydrate Content, and Nutritional Balance Per Bag
Sour gummy worms are also popular with people who are conscious of their calorie and carbohydrate intake per bag. For typical products, a single bag (about 50g) contains approximately 150–200 kcal and around 30–40g of carbohydrates. Per piece, that’s about 10–15 kcal and 2–3g of carbohydrates.
The nutritional balance is as follows:
| Item | Per Bag (50g) Reference Value |
|---|---|
| Calories | 150–200 kcal |
| Carbohydrates | 30–40g |
| Fat | 0–1g |
| Protein | 2–4g (from gelatin) |
| Dietary Fiber | 0–2g (depends on the product) |
While they contain almost no fat, they are high in sugar, so it’s important not to overeat. In recent years, there have been releases of low-sugar and high-fiber options, attracting attention from health-conscious consumers.

Storing, Managing, and Troubleshooting sour gummy worms
Proper Storage Methods and Shelf Life Guidelines
To keep sour gummy worms tasting their best, proper storage is essential. Basically, avoid direct sunlight and high humidity, and store them at room temperature in an airtight container or zipper bag. If unopened, you can enjoy them up to the “best by” date on the package. Once opened, it’s best to finish them within about two weeks. Storing them in the fridge can sometimes lead to stickiness from moisture, so unless the room is particularly hot, it’s ideal to avoid refrigeration. Including a desiccant packet can also help maintain the gummies’ softness for longer.
| Condition | Storage Location | Recommended Period | Key Points |
|---|---|---|---|
| Unopened | Room temp, dark place | Until best by date | Be careful not to damage the bag |
| After opening | Airtight container, room temp | Within 2 weeks | No humidity/direct sunlight |
| Summer/Hot weather | Refrigerator | Within 1 week | Prevent stickiness |
Common Issues and Solutions
Sour gummy worms are sensitive to storage conditions and can change easily. The most common problems are stickiness, discoloration, and hardening. If they become sticky, lightly dusting with powdered sugar will help improve the texture. Discoloration or a strange odor are signs of deterioration, so avoid eating them. If they become hard, sometimes leaving them in a low-humidity place for a while will bring back their softness. The following list summarizes solutions for each issue:
- If they’re very sticky
→ Lightly dust with powdered sugar - If there is discoloration or a strange odor
→ Discard without eating - If the gummies have hardened
→ Place in an airtight container at room temperature and wait
